Mizzou entered the 9th weekend of SEC play without a conference victory. The Tigers will enter the final weekend of the regular season looking to extend a 3-game SEC winning streak.
After clinching the series on Saturday, Mizzou broke out the brooms on Sunday in College Station. The Tigers left no doubt, delivering a 10-1 thumping of the Aggies to complete the sweep.

After 12 miserable weeks of 13-35 baseball, things clicked for the Tigers in Week 13. Mizzou not only went 3-0 against Texas A&M, the Tigers won the series by a margin of 23-8.
On Sunday, Jackson Lovich led the offensive attack. The starting shortstop collected 3 RBIs in a 3-for-5 day at the plate that was only a single short of the cycle. Lovich, the leadoff hitter, got it started with a solo homer in the top of the 1st.
On the mound, Will Libbert picked up the win after allowing only 1 run on 5 innings of 1-hit baseball, striking out 5 Aggies. Josh McDevitt tossed 4 scoreless frames to collect the save.
For the first time since conference play began, Mizzou heads home with some momentum. The Tigers close out the regular season hosting Mississippi State.
